Proper noun edit
Khalaf (plural Khalafs)
- A surname from Arabic.
Statistics edit
- According to the 2010 United States Census, Khalaf is the 20047th most common surname in the United States, belonging to 1334 individuals. Khalaf is most common among White (85.68%) individuals.
